下载本文档
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
应用开发中心咨询顾问客户需求分析文档应用开发中心的咨询顾问在开展客户需求分析工作时,需遵循系统化、结构化的方法论,确保从客户业务痛点出发,精准提炼需求,为后续应用系统设计提供可靠依据。需求分析作为项目启动阶段的核心环节,其质量直接影响系统实施的成败及客户满意度。本文将围绕需求分析的核心流程、关键要素及实施要点展开论述,结合企业级应用开发的实际场景,探讨如何构建科学的需求分析体系。需求分析的核心流程应包含三个阶段:初步沟通、深入调研和需求确认。初步沟通阶段主要建立客户与顾问之间的信任关系,通过访谈、问卷等方式收集客户的初步期望和痛点。顾问需具备良好的沟通技巧,引导客户清晰表达需求,同时避免主观臆断。深入调研阶段是需求分析的关键环节,顾问需运用多种方法,如业务流程梳理、用户画像构建、数据建模等,全面理解客户的业务场景和技术要求。需求确认阶段则通过原型验证、需求评审会等形式,确保客户对需求的理解与顾问的解析保持一致。这一流程需贯穿整个项目周期,在系统迭代中持续优化。在需求分析过程中,业务流程梳理是基础性工作。顾问需通过流程图、活动图等可视化工具,将客户的业务运作转化为可度量的模型。以某企业的采购管理为例,顾问需从采购申请、审批、执行到付款的全流程进行梳理,识别其中的断点、瓶颈和冗余环节。例如,传统采购流程中纸质单据流转效率低下,系统需求应重点解决电子化审批和自动化对账问题。业务流程梳理不仅帮助顾问理解客户的当前状态,更为后续的流程优化提供依据,实现"以客户为中心"的设计理念。用户需求分类是确保需求完整性的关键。顾问需将收集到的需求按照性质分为功能性需求、非功能性需求和业务规则需求三类。功能性需求描述系统应具备的具体功能,如订单管理模块需支持订单创建、修改、查询等操作;非功能性需求则关注系统的性能、安全、可用性等指标,例如系统响应时间应控制在3秒以内;业务规则需求反映行业或客户的特殊规定,如金融行业的反洗钱合规要求。通过分类管理,顾问可建立清晰的需求矩阵,避免遗漏关键需求,为系统设计提供全面指导。数据需求分析直接影响系统的数据架构设计。顾问需识别客户的核心数据资产,分析数据的来源、流向、存储方式及安全要求。例如,电商平台需关注商品信息、交易记录、用户行为等数据的整合与治理。顾问应通过数据字典、ETL流程图等工具,明确数据标准、清洗规则和迁移方案。数据需求分析不仅是技术层面的考量,更涉及客户的商业决策,如数据报表的生成频率、维度组合等,直接影响客户的经营分析能力。这一环节需与数据专家协同完成,确保技术实现的可行性。需求优先级排序是资源分配的重要依据。顾问需与客户共同制定需求优先级,可采用MoSCoW方法(Musthave,Shouldhave,Couldhave,Won'thave)或Kano模型(基本型、期望型、魅力型)进行分类。例如,某企业OA系统升级项目中,电子签章功能属于Musthave,而智能会议管理属于Couldhave。优先级排序需考虑客户的核心痛点、实施周期和预算限制,确保关键需求优先落地。顾问应引导客户平衡需求与资源,避免过度设计,实现价值最大化。需求文档的规范化编制是需求管理的保障。标准的文档结构应包含需求描述、业务场景、验收标准、优先级等信息,并采用客观、清晰的语言表述。以某银行信贷系统为例,需求文档需明确贷款申请的审批流程、额度计算规则、风险监控指标等。文档编制过程中,顾问需与客户保持持续沟通,确保需求描述的准确性。部分复杂需求可配合原型图、时序图等可视化工具,降低沟通成本。需求文档的版本管理同样重要,需记录每次变更的背景、内容和影响范围。敏捷开发中的需求管理需适应迭代特性。在Scrum框架下,顾问应协助客户建立产品待办列表,按Sprint周期细化需求。每个Sprint开始前,通过需求评审会确保团队对需求的理解一致。敏捷环境下的需求变更更为频繁,顾问需建立快速响应机制,评估变更对进度和成本的影响。例如,某电商项目在Sprint3发现客户需增加会员积分功能,顾问需评估其工作量、依赖关系,并调整后续计划。敏捷需求管理强调协作与透明,确保需求与开发进度同步演进。需求验证是确保需求质量的关键环节。顾问需设计验证方案,通过用户测试、场景模拟等方式确认需求实现效果。例如,某医疗系统上线前,顾问组织医生模拟挂号、开药的完整流程,检验系统响应速度和操作便捷性。验证过程中发现的问题需及时反馈给开发团队,形成闭环管理。部分高风险需求应进行多轮验证,确保业务连续性。需求验证不仅是技术测试,更是业务确认,需邀请客户关键用户全程参与。需求变更管理需建立规范的流程。顾问应协助客户制定变更控制委员会(CCB),明确变更申请、评估、审批的路径。变更评估需考虑对进度、成本、资源的影响,并制定应对计划。例如,某企业资源规划系统实施过程中,客户提出增加供应商管理模块,顾问需评估其工作量、技术依赖,并建议分阶段实施。规范的变更管理既满足客户的灵活性需求,又控制项目风险,实现平衡发展。需求分析的质量直接影响客户的投资回报率。顾问需将需求分析与企业战略相结合,确保系统设计支持业务发展。例如,某制造企业通过需求分析发现其库存管理效率低下,系统升级后库存周转率提升20%,年节约成本
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
评论
0/150
提交评论